Alcatel OneTouch Flash ‘Selfie’ Smartphone Launched at Rs 9,999
Alcatel launches a new smartphone that comes with an insanely powerful front facing shooter. After HTC and Lava, Alcatel is the handset maker to release a new selfie-centric smartphone - OneTouch Flash.
The Alcatel OneTouch Flash has a 5-megapixel camera above the screen. The company claims the device has been completely designed in France. The OneTouch Flash was first unveiled in Thailand, and now it has been revealed in India.

"FLASH is built truly for selfie fans with 2 key points - a good resolution front facing camera that also has the Beauty Selfie to enhance the user's photo without the need of any extra application", said Praveen Valecha, Regional Director, APAC, Alcatel One Touch.
These days most smartphones have decent front-facing cameras, but they do not match the cameras on the rear of the handsets. Unlike the HTC Desire Eye, which costs a lot, the Alcatel OneTouch will be priced economically. It will be made exclusively on Flipkart, staring November 21 at an affordable price of Rs. 9,999.
The OneTouch Flash has a 5.5-inch 720p HD screen and the octa-core processor coupled with 1GB of RAM and 8GB of ROM, which further can be expanded via microSD card slot. It also features a 13MP rear facing camera. The phone runs Android 4.4 Kitkat.
As mentioned earlier, the device comes with a 5MP front-facing shooter. The makers have added a 3,200mAh battery inside. Other connectivity options include: Wi-Fi, 3G/2G, GPS and Bluetooth.
Alcatel has struggled to make a huge dent in the Indian handset market dominated by the likes of Samsung and Xiaomi. Whether the Alcatel OneTouch Flash will be able to receive positive response from users is still unknown.
